August 24, 2015

President Barack Obama on Monday picked up the support of another Democratic senator for the Iran nuclear deal as Debbie Stabenow of Michigan announced that she will vote to allow the pact to go ahead.

“I have determined that the imminent threat of Iran having a nuclear weapon outweighs any flaws I see in the international agreement. For this reason, I must support the agreement,” Stabenow said in a statement.
